Join our dedicated team at Busy Bees in Coventry Allesley Green, an Ofsted-rated Outstanding facility with a capacity of 46 children. Our longstanding staff includes Centre Director Becky Curran, with 32 years of experience, alongside Chris Lewis and Patricia Ward, each with 20 and 10 years, respectively. We pride ourselves on strong community ties, collaborating with our local Onestop, which judges our internal competitions, and participating in community service activities like litter picking. Conveniently located with a bus terminal directly opposite the center, we provide easy access to both Coventry and Birmingham. Staff members enjoy free lunch and parking, and we are open to exploring flexible working options upon request, creating a supportive and adaptable work environment.
